Iran and Kuwait hold first ministerial call since six-week war

ALBAWABA-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araghchi and his Kuwaiti counterpart, Sheikh Jarrah Jaber Al-Ahmad Al-Sabah, held their first publicly reported phone conversation since the six-week Iran-US conflict, signaling a tentative effort to rebuild relations following Iranian strikes on Kuwaiti territory and US-linked infrastructure earlier this year.
